Salvado forced to eat his words, apologises after calling Konshens-Busy Signal battle organizers greedy.

Comedian Salvado has been forced to eat his own words following a long tirade on Social media attacking the organizers of the Konshens – Busy Signal battle. He poured out his scorn on the organisers of the battle after learning it had been scheduled on the same date (28th August) as Irene Ntale’s maiden concert.

He posted:

“Busy Signal Vs Konshens on the 28th August.. Wow, wow, wow this is a show I’ve only dreamt about in a long … And when I say long I mean a very long time.. Coz these are two of my biggest Jamaican artists.. 
But wait…. 28th August.. Sounds a familiar date.. Oh Crap.. That’s when my girl ‪#‎IreneNtale is Launching her ‪#‎GyoberaAlbum.

But the question is… Who is Busy Signal?? Who is Konshens?? Apart from what I know on Google..Fortunately I can’t say the same about #IreneNtale coz I’ve had the honor of seeing her evolve from a back up singer to arguably the best female artist we have today and I’m so proud of her hustle, Determination and drive to be who she is today.

I’m very disappointed in the organizers of the “Jamaican Battle” because out of greed, they didn’t even acknowledge that a young Ugandan female artists who has been interviewed on World BBC News in the UK as a UGANDAN DIVA is to launch her first ever album as an established artist. This is just heart breaking.”

In a sudden twist of events, Salvado deleted the post and replaced it with an apology:

“In respect of what Pepsi has done over the years in support of local talent including myself, I’ve deleted my post, if there has been any damage done, I sincerely apologize, it was never my intention.”
